The Role of a Car Locksmith

A car locksmith, also understood as an automotive locksmith, is a specialist who focuses on the security of vehicles. Their main responsibilities consist of:

  1. Key Duplication: Creating duplicate keys for vehicle owners, typically when the initial key is lost or damaged.
  2. Key Programming: Programming electronic or chip keys for modern-day vehicles that require specific coding to operate.
  3. Lock Repair and Replacement: Fixing or replacing harmed locks on car doors, trunks, and ignition systems.
  4. Lockout Assistance: Helping vehicle owners who have been locked out of their cars and trucks, providing fast and efficient gain access to.
  5. Security Consultation: Advising clients on the best ways to secure their vehicles versus theft and unapproved access.
  6. Setup of Security Systems: Installing advanced security systems, such as immobilizers and alarms, to boost vehicle security.

The Tools of the Trade

car locksmith near me locksmith professionals use a variety of specialized tools to perform their jobs. Some of the most typical tools include:

  • Key Machines: These machines are utilized to cut and replicate keys precisely.
  • Select Sets: Sets of lock picks utilized to manipulate the pins inside a lock and open it without a key.
  • Decoders: Devices that checked out the special codes of chip keys, permitting locksmith professionals to program new keys.
  • Drill Rigs: Used as a last option to drill out locks that can not be selected or have been harmed beyond repair.
  • Laptop and Software: For programming and diagnosing concerns with electronic locks and security systems.
  • Telescopic Mirrors: These mirrors aid locksmith professionals see into tight areas, such as keyholes, to much better understand the lock system.
  • Stress Wrenches: Tools utilized to apply the necessary tension to a lock while selecting it.

Difficulties Faced by Car Locksmiths

In spite of the high demand for their services, car locksmith professionals face several challenges:

  1. Technological Advancements: Modern vehicles typically come with advanced security functions, such as keyless entry and smart keys, which require specialized understanding and tools.
  2. Security Risks: Locksmiths must be vigilant about security threats, including the possibility of their services being utilized for prohibited activities.
  3. Regulative Compliance: Navigating the legal and regulatory landscape, which can vary by region, is a constant obstacle.
  4. Consumer Trust: Building and preserving trust with clients is vital, specifically when handling sensitive information and access to personal effects.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Locksmiths

  1. How do I discover a trustworthy car locksmith?

    • Try to find locksmiths with excellent reviews and a strong credibility. Examine if they are accredited and insured. You can also ask for recommendations from buddies, family, or local automotive online forums.
  2. Can a car locksmith open a car without a key?

    • Yes, car cheap locksmith for car keys near me professionals are trained to open cars without causing damage. They utilize lock picking, key extraction, and other strategies to acquire access.
  3. How long does it take to get a brand-new key made?

    • The time it requires to make a brand-new key depends upon the complexity of the lock and the type of key. Basic mechanical keys can be made in a few minutes, while electronic keys may take an hour or more.
  4. What should I do if I lose my car keys?

    • Contact a relied on car locksmith right away. They can offer a brand-new key and help you secure your vehicle. It's likewise a good concept to report the lost keys to your insurer and the authorities, particularly if you think foul play.
  5. Are car locksmith professionals covered by insurance coverage?

    • Numerous insurance policies cover the cost of locksmith services if the requirement develops due to a covered incident, such as a break-in. Check your policy to see if locksmith services are included.
  6. Can a car locksmith aid with a broken key in the ignition?

    • Yes, car locksmith professionals can extract broken keys from locks and replace the key or the lock if necessary.
